Modi’s cabinet resilience tested as protests push Pradhan resignation

TL;DR Summary
Thousands of youth-led protesters in New Delhi demand Education Minister Dharmendra Pradhan’s resignation over exam leaks, framing it as part of a long-running pattern under Modi in which ministers face controversy but are rarely forced out; the piece recalls cases from Mahesh Sharma’s Dadri comments to Smriti Irani and Bandaru Dattatreya during Rohith Vemula’s protests, Ajay Mishra Teni after Lakhimpur Kheri, and notes Harsh Vardhan’s pandemic resignation, while opposition parties join the demonstrations.
